Please be sure and view the display in the lobby of the new lockers to be installed in the men’s and women’s locker rooms. The display includes a picture of the lockers and the color choices for the locker doors, inside, and solid surface counter tops for the towel drops and vanities.
I have received questions about the lighting in the locker rooms and if it will change because the lockers are darker than the current lockers. At this point we are going to use the lighting system currently in place and once the lockers are installed we will determine if we need to add lights in locations throughout the locker rooms.
The current lighting system is placed inside a box on top of the lockers with an egg-crate grate on top of the box. This box limits the amount of light and we believe by removing the lights from the box that it will actually create more light than currently exists.

In the mean time I wanted to offer some additional information about the expansion. It will be a two-story expansion with 2400 additional square feet in the weight room (1st floor) and 2400 additional square feet in the business/membership office (2nd floor). In addition to the expansion, we will be remodeling 7200 square feet of the existing weight room and stretching area and approximately 2000 square feet of the business/membership office.
The expansion is not only bigger but it’s better. The new weight room will include windows on three sides, therefore allowing natural light to flow through the entire weight room. We will be adding or replacing a few pieces of weight equipment but a big goal is to allow more space in the weight room and create more stretching and functional training areas. We will be replacing the ceiling tiles and light fixtures and will be adding some dimension to the ceiling with “painted clouds”. The current rubber floor and carpet will be replaced with Ramflex Mondo flooring in a light maple color giving the look of hardwood but the function of rubber. The area will be finished off with new paint in warm greys and accent colors.
The business/membership office will include more productive office spaces to better serve our members and guests in addition to some much needed conference room space.

Continuous Improvement - I am honored and proud to say that in the last four years, Greenwood Athletic and Tennis Club has spent an average of nearly $1.6 million annually on capital improvements (the industry standard being $300,000). You have seen these improvements in the outdoor pool, weight room equipment, cardiovascular equipment, HVAC replacement and upgrades and tennis club repairs and remodels. 2008 will bring the expansion of the weight room and membership offices, indoor pool remodel and men’s and women’s locker upgrades just to name a few.
